Khadir Mohideen College of Arts and Science
Khadir Mohideen College of Arts and Science is one of the ancient colleges affiliated to Bharathidasan University.

Khadir Mohideen College of Arts and Science, Thanjavur, Tamil NaduKhadir Mohideen College of Arts and Science is one of the ancient colleges for minority community, affiliated to Bharathidasan University, Trichy. The college runs with the sole mission to provide cost effective and quality education to them, so that they are not deprived from the opportunities of receiving higher education. Other socially backward and deprived members of the society, including fisherman, also get this advantage as well. Over the years the college has grown by leaps and bounds. In 2005 it celebrated its Golden Jubilee. At present Khadir Mohideen College of Arts and Science offers several courses including- BA, B.Sc, B.Com, Bachelor of Business Administration (BBA), M.Com, M.Sc and Master of Computer Application (MCA). In addition to offering diverse courses, the college also instills religious and moral values to the students, simultaneously imparting guidance to them in socially useful creative services, leading to an all round development of their persona. The College has been Nationally Accredited B++ by NAAC.
